Services BillyLids Therapy – Norman Park offers for autism
BillyLids Therapy – Norman Park lists sensory processing and fine motor support among its services. For children with autism spectrum disorder, sensory processing difficulties are common and may affect how a child responds to sounds, textures, movement, or visual input in everyday settings. According to its listing, the clinic addresses sensory needs through activities that may include use of sensory equipment such as swings or weighted items, or graded exposure to different textures and environments to help children build tolerance and regulation skills. Fine motor development is also frequently relevant for autistic children, as difficulties with hand strength, coordination, or pencil control can impact self-care, play, and learning. BillyLids Therapy – Norman Park lists fine motor interventions that may involve hand exercises, threading activities, or play-based tasks designed to strengthen small muscle groups and improve coordination.
Children with autism may benefit from a combined approach addressing both areas—for example, a child might work on hand strength through craft or construction play while also engaging in calming or organising sensory input. It is important to note that occupational therapists cannot diagnose autism spectrum disorder; diagnosis is made by medical professionals. About autism
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D) is a developmental difference that shapes how children process information, communicate, and respond to their sensory environment. In Australia, autism is identified across a wide range of ages, and many families first speak with a GP or paediatrician about referrals for assessment after noticing differences in play, communication, sensory responses, or daily routines.

Common questions
Can an occupational therapist diagnose autism in my child?
No. Occupational therapists cannot diagnose autism spectrum disorder. Diagnosis is made by medical professionals such as paediatricians, developmental paediatricians, or psychologists. An occupational therapist can assess how sensory processing or fine motor difficulties affect your child's daily functioning and recommend support strategies, but diagnostic assessment requires a medical pathway.

What should I expect in a sensory processing or fine motor session?
Sessions typically involve play-based or structured activities tailored to your child's needs. For sensory work, this might include movement activities or texture exploration. For fine motor, activities may focus on hand strength and coordination through craft, construction, or everyday tasks. The occupational therapist will work with your child and provide guidance to support progress at home.
